The Screed Operator is responsible for operating the screed at the rear of the paving machine and for accurately setting the depth and width of asphalt during placement. This role is critical to the quality, smoothness, and rideability of the finished surface.
Responsibilities
- Responsible for setting asphalt depth and width to exact specifications, ensuring a consistent and high-quality finished surface as part of the road-building process
- Set and monitor screed depth and width to ensure asphalt is laid in accordance with project specifications
- Perform handwork, including shoveling asphalt into holes or areas inaccessible to the paving machine, as required
